First of all I have to say that Tank and the Bangas are quite an experience. I was super tired that day and close to cancelling but I am so happy that I did not.

They were supported by „Sweet Crude“, a jazzy band from New Orleans coming together with a violin and being lead by a male and a female voice. They were quite good, singing partly in French and the rest in English. My friend was not too convinced by their keyboard work but all in all they did a good job.

WhatsApp Image 2019-02-20 at 12.34.37.2

When Tank and the Bangas came on stage, I first thought Tank, the lead singer, was drunk. But that is apparently just how she moves on stage. Her backup singer was wearing the most incredible hoops and had a wonderful voice. Tank’s voice is hard to describe because I feel like she has different versions. In addition to her normal talking voice there’s the „I am telling you a story“-mode in which her voice is quite high, comparable to the voice of an 11 year old. Further there is her rap-voice, a bit harsh, a bit rougher, a bit deeper. And finally her singing, which just cannot to be explained but has to be experienced. It is pure beauty for the ears.

In the end, Tank and the Bangas formed a collaboration with Sweet Crude and together they performed a song about people just trying to do their best. In that combination you could really see the difference in stage experience between the two bands. While Tank was just freestyling, the female lead of Sweet Crude obviously had more difficulties with just joining the flow.

Tank’s dance moves, which I first interpreted as drunkenness, were finally transferred to the crowd, which was hilarious to be part of.
